Qase defects API
Defects raised against failed test results.
Qase defects API is one of 7 APIs that Qase publishes on the APIs.io network, described by a machine-readable OpenAPI specification.
Tagged areas include defects. The published artifact set on APIs.io includes an OpenAPI specification, an API reference, and API documentation.
This API exposes 5 operations across 4 paths, and defines 6 schemas. It is described by OpenAPI 3.0.3, at version 1.0.
Requests are made against a single base URL, https://api.qase.io/v1.

An API key is passed in the header as Token (TokenAuth).
By default, every request must be authenticated.
TokenAuth— A personal or application API token. Create it in the Qase app under Settings and pass it in the Token header on every request. All requests must use HTTPS.
